Hi all, my pilot acts strange and i need some advice.
I have a great blue spark at the plug, and I have removed the Carb and cleaned it. I noticed that the reed gasket was damaged and repaired by some sort of silicone gasket. I removed it and cleaned it and made both new gaskets of some papergasket material. I have Brand new fuel on it and the fuel pump is working. I have fuel in the Carb.
I try to fire it up and it almost starts and fires up but it lacks the final fire to run. It is so close!!!
It is so close that it gets a bit warm.
What would be your advice?

What about compression? 3 things needed to run. Spark, fuel, and compression... You have 2 of them but you need to verify the 3rd before going any farther...
